To replace the tail light assembly on your F-150 GEN 13 It’s easy. You will need to access the tail light housing, disconnect the tail light, remove the tail light housing as well as carry out a few other steps. You can carry out this tutorial of 4 chapters in 45 minutes. Bring your 8 mm socket and your ratchet and let’s get started!

Remove the tail light housing
To replace the tail light on your vehicle, you need to open the tail gate.
To detach the taillight assembly from the vehicle body, remove the two bolts with a ratchet and an 8mm socket. Then pull on it to disengage the retaining lugs from their slots. You can use a car trim removal tool.
Disconnect the tail light
Disconnect the two connectors by pressing on the retaining tabs. You can now remove the light.
Reconnect the tail light
Take the new tail light.
Reconnect the power connectors.
Put the tail light housing back
The light is held in place by studs encased directly in the car body. Put the light back in.
Screw the two holding bolts back in.
Operation complete.
